#define _XOPEN_SOURCE
#include <unistd.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include <SWI-Prolog.h>
#include "clib.h"
/* -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-
Simple interface to the Unix password encryption routine. Implemented
for providing authorization in the multi-threaded Prolog based HTTP
deamon and therefore providing a thread-safe interface.
-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- */
#ifdef _REENTRANT
#include <pthread.h>
static pthread_mutex_t mutex = PTHREAD_MUTEX_INITIALIZER;
#define LOCK() pthread_mutex_lock(&mutex)
#define UNLOCK() pthread_mutex_unlock(&mutex)
#else
#define LOCK()
#define UNLOCK()
#endif
static foreign_t
pl_crypt(term_t passwd, term_t encrypted)
{ char *p, *e;
char s[3];
if ( !PL_get_chars(passwd, &p, CVT_ATOM|CVT_STRING|CVT_LIST|BUF_RING) )
return pl_error("crypt", 2, NULL, ERR_ARGTYPE,
1, passwd, "text");
if ( PL_get_chars(encrypted, &e, CVT_ATOM|CVT_STRING|CVT_LIST|BUF_RING) )
{ int rval;
char *s2;
s[0] = e[0];
s[1] = e[1];
s[2] = '\0';
LOCK();
s2 = crypt(p, s);
rval = (strcmp(s2, e) == 0 ? TRUE : FALSE);
UNLOCK();
return rval;
} else
{ term_t tail = PL_copy_term_ref(encrypted);
term_t head = PL_new_term_ref();
int n;
int (*unify)(term_t t, const char *s) = PL_unify_list_codes;
char *s2;
int rval;
for(n=0; n<2; n++)
{ if ( PL_get_list(tail, head, tail) )
{ int i;
char *t;
if ( PL_get_integer(head, &i) && i>=0 && i<=255 )
{ s[n] = i;
} else if ( PL_get_atom_chars(head, &t) && t[1] == '\0' )
{ s[n] = t[0];
unify = PL_unify_list_chars;
} else
return pl_error("crypt", 2, NULL, ERR_ARGTYPE,
2, head, "character");
} else
break;
}
for( ; n < 2; n++ )
{ int c = 'a'+(int)(26.0*rand()/(RAND_MAX+1.0));
if ( rand() & 0x1 )
c += 'A' - 'a';
s[n] = c;
}
s[n] = 0;
LOCK();
s2 = crypt(p, s);
rval = (*unify)(encrypted, s2);
UNLOCK();
return rval;
}
}
install_t
install_crypt()
{ PL_register_foreign("crypt", 2, pl_crypt, 0);
}
